Wonderful are your works; my soul … WebWhat does Psalm 139:23 mean? Although David despised the wicked who spoke against God and took His name in vain, he realized he was not perfect. He was keenly aware that sin might be lurking in his heart and mind. Therefore, he asked the Lord to search his heart and know his thoughts. chillicothe laundry https://mcmasterpdi.com
